#a4f136 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a4f136 is composed of 64.3% red, 94.5%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 84.7 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 57.8%. #a4f136 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#49e300.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

Shades and Tints of #a4f136

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f7feed is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4f136

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949691 is the less saturated color, while #a5f92e is the most saturated one.
